I don't really know what you could be behind here. What would he limp-cap? AA, KK, QQ, AK? The worst you do is split with any of those hands. And he'd play AA EXACTLY like this on that flop. Wouldn't you?

I think I only call the river 3-bet, because I would just end up scared of the flush and most likely leave a bet out there. I just don't know what he could have limped-capped that would be a flush. K9s for the straight-flush? Unlikely.

But, then again, he is a 52/3 donk, and as long as it was 2 back to him on preflop, and a 52 would NEVER fold with some money in there, he may have just thrown the extra bet in to speed up play, and knowing he'd get two callers.

That opens up his range quite a bit.
